Output d4111838824862f118d9ae90e58b14c2a33f83cbacbc4a3e4707cd893b587ec7:6
- value
- 689106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 897ac27c6159585b17840d0460eaabba3e00c7f8 OP_EQUAL
- address
- 3EDwZKSTz6YJkANE6xZqd7pbfYz9aFTzJg
- transaction
- d4111838824862f118d9ae90e58b14c2a33f83cbacbc4a3e4707cd893b587ec7
- confirmations
- 309342
- spent
- true